Talk Talk Router: What's the management port?


[link to this post]
 
Just set a friend up on Talk-Talk broadband this afternoon; she had the supplied Talk-Talk (Philips/SMC?) router.

I thought I'd set it up to allow me to do remote management from my static IP but I can't get through (I can ping the router OK)

Can anyone tell me what TCP port is used for remote management on this system? I've tried 1900 and 8080 as suggested by a few searches (as well as straight TCP/80) but it doesn't work.

Hi

It is managed over port 80

You must enable this feature; it is not enabled "out of the box"

To enable remote management:
1) connect to the router's web interface by navigating to its IP address within a web browser. The default IP address for this router is 192.168.2.1
2) Click on Advanced Settings
3) Click on System
4) Click on Remote Management

Thanks for your mail.

I did get this working eventually - the main problem being that the user's internet connection had dropped, hence my lack of success remotely!

Just for the record - the port was TCP/8080 - the model is a SNA5630NS/05 and in fact it did say this in the router's online help - I had tried that too but of course the router didn't have an IP at that point so it wasn't much use!
